Specifically, an annular groove 13 matched with the annular plate 7 is formed in one side of the impeller 5, a motor 14 is fixedly connected to one side of the pump head 1, and one end of the rotating shaft 4 is fixedly connected with the output end of the motor 14.
Specifically, a junction box 15 is fixedly connected to the top of the motor 14, and a handle 16 is arranged on the top of the junction box 15.
Specifically, the bottom of the motor 14 is fixedly connected with a supporting seat 17, the bottom of the supporting seat 17 is fixedly connected with a bottom plate 18, and the bottom of the arc-shaped plate 8 is fixedly connected with the top of the bottom plate 18.
Specifically, the impeller 5 is made of anticorrosive hard rubber, and the protective cover 6 is made of anticorrosive rubber.

During the use, the rotatory pivot 4 that drives of motor 14 rotates, the rotation drives impeller 5 and rotates, make outside water pass through the inside that inlet tube 2 got into pump head 1, then discharge through outlet pipe 3, when rotating, lag 6 can effectually prevent corrosive liquids and get into the inside of motor 14, when vibrations take place simultaneously, spheroid 9 will extrude shell 10 downwards, shell 10 will extrude spring 12 downwards, spring 12 plays certain buffering effect, the vibrations that produce when alleviating whole work.
